铃声下载的两个问题,希望得到解决....
一:我现在做了图片和铃声的下载,在最后下载的时候应该设置相应的返回类型。。
如:<%response.setContentType("image/png")%>;这是设置图片的,在模拟器
中没有问题。可是铃声的怎么设置???
我试过<%response.setContentType("audio/mid")%>等。。可是模拟器提示错
误。。
二:在手机下载完图片或者铃声时,我们怎么才能知道,已经下载完毕。。下载中和
下载完毕应该是sp或cp自己写得吧。如果真是自己写,谁可以提供这方面的方
法。
注:上面两个问题对于我真的很急。。只要解决问题另外加分。谢````````````
至于TOMCAT的MIME映射应该是配置web.xml中
如:
<mime-mapping>
<extension>zip</extension>
<mime-type>application/zip</mime-type>
</mime-mapping>
配置相关的下载类型就可以了。
关于下载进度条的我没有做过,不过我认为应该是终端自适用的,和sp没有多大关系!
一:我现在做了图片和铃声的下载,在最后下载的时候应该设置相应的返回类型。。
如:<%response.setContentType("image/png")%>;这是设置图片的,在模拟器
中没有问题。可是铃声的怎么设置???
我试过<%response.setContentType("audio/mid")%>等。。可是模拟器提示错
误。。
这种方式不行的,只能连实际的图铃,否则WAP1.2的手机可能会认为文件类型错
二:在手机下载完图片或者铃声时,我们怎么才能知道,已经下载完毕。。下载中和
下载完毕应该是sp或cp自己写得吧。如果真是自己写,谁可以提供这方面的方
法。
不需要自己写
WAP1.2版本--
下载规范是按照download fun(DLF)
在下载URL中需要包含下载文件URL地址/下载完成或失败后的URL地址/文件大小
缺一不可
下载原理是无论下载成功与否,都会转到下载完成或失败后的URL地址,DLF服务器自动在其后加上STATUS参数,STATUS=OK表示下载成功,其他表示不同错误.可以参考openwave网站的说明.
DLF其实SO EASY....
To goldchocobo(陆行鸟):
这种方式不行的,只能连实际的图铃,否则WAP1.2的手机可能会认为文件类型错
"只能连实际的图铃",你是指下载时的那个图铃文件的实际路径嘛??????
<%response.setContentType("image/png")%>;
这段语句不写可以嘛???????????????????
这句话DI意思是,比如联通的规范
uplink:download?source=http://abc.com/dlf/chocobo.png&size=5060&object=phone:wallpaper&status=http://www.abc.com/dlf/downOver.asp
你如果将http://abc.com/dlf/chocobo.png,改成http://abc.com/dlf/chocobo.asp,即使你将头写成contenttype="image/png",手机也会报错
我曾经好象试过的,这样写不行